Abstract

Abstract Traditional flood design methods are increasingly supplemented by risk‐oriented methods based on comprehensive risk analysis. This analysis requires: (1) the estimation of flood hazard that represents intensity of a flood, (2) estimation of vulnerability, e.g. percentage of damage to total property as a function of flood depth and duration, and (3) the consequences of flooding, e.g. loss of life and damage to property. In this study, flood hazard maps of the B alu‐ T ongikhal R iver system within the eastern part of D haka C ity are prepared using geoprocessing tools and a hydrodynamic model.
